What’s there to see and do in Botzenweiler?
While exploring the area, visit family-friendly sights like Bayerisches Eisenbahnmuseum, or get outside and enjoy nature at Wester-Weiher. In the larger area, you’ll find St. George Church and Dinkelsbuehl Golfclub.
